Ticket: AddressSnap widget — dropdown sign-off needed. The autocomplete widget on the Larkmoor checkout page now debounces keystrokes at 200ms and falls back to manual entry when the suggestion service times out. Change is staged and passing integration tests. New folks: this is a good example of our standard rollout flow, so follow along. Before we ship, the change needs sign-off from the widget's owner:

account owner for bawip-tahag: Raleth Quenok

// Baseline file for the Ostermill static-analysis gate.
// This constant pins the suppressed-findings snapshot so new
// violations fail CI while legacy ones stay grandfathered.
// Release manager: regenerate only after a triage pass, never
// to silence a red build. The snapshot was produced from the
// build whose identifier appears below.

pipeline stamp: htk9_ce63042d9

## Authentication

The Taxfern lookup cache refreshes jurisdiction rates hourly from the internal Ratepost service. All refresh calls must carry a service key in the request header; unauthenticated calls are dropped silently, which shows up as stale-rate alerts rather than errors. If you're on call and see staleness past two hours, first verify the key has not been rotated out from under the cache. Keys live in the deploy config, not in code. For emergency manual refreshes from the bastion, use the key below.

app token of kagap-fahag = zpat2_0m

Fan-out backpressure for the Quillet notifier: when the queue depth crosses the soft limit, the dispatcher sheds low-priority pushes and batches the rest at 500ms intervals. Reviewer should confirm the shed counter is exported and that retries respect the jitter window. Once merged, the release artifact gets re-signed by the pipeline, which expects the deploy key shown below.

deploy key for bawep-yawif: bky6_GQhaSt